Web Development


MongoDB for Beginners - Fast track

Learn to use MongoDB fast and easily with Edwin Diaz

4.45 (81 reviews)

MongoDB for Beginners - Fast track


3.5 hours


Nov 2019

Last Update
Regular Price


Blue Host
Fast, easy, and secure WordPress hosting in minutes + 1 free domain name
65%OFF : $2.95/month

What you will learn

You will learn what mongoDB is really about in an easy way

Install and use mongoDB

Learn all the fundamentals

Schema Modeling

Learn to use Many Query Methods

Learn to connect mongoDB to other languages

You will learn how to relate data

You will learn about operators


In this course, you will learn all the fundamentals of MongoDB plus the most popular advanced features. You can follow this course along with the documentation and compliment your learning.

MongoDB is one of the top database solutions out there right now. Every developer needs to know how to use this tool to take advantage of many nice features.

I've built this course with a beginner's mindset but at the same with the busy developer in mind. I put myself in a beginner's shoes and designed this course in a very easy to digest manner.

Technology moves really quick and there is no time to spend years learning something now-days. We simply do not have the luxury of time to take years to learn something new, especially a tool like MongoDB.

Learning a new language well can take several years but a tool like MongoDB should be learned fast so that we can integrate it with our favorite languages or tools.

MongoDB has a large API that can be used to plug it into any popular language out there, so there is no excuse not to learn it.


The First Steps & The Basics



Some Data Files


What is MongoDB

Installing mongoDB for Windows

Installing mongoDB for MAC OS

Using MongoDB in a Shell

Using mongoDB in a GUI part 1

Using mongoDB in a GUI part 2

Importing Data to work with

CRUD - Create / Insert Methods

The "insert Methods

The Find Methods

The Update Methods

Save Methods

Delete Methods

More complex queries


$in & $nin

$or and $nor

$and Operator





Schema & Validation

MongoDB Schema Explanation

MongoDb Document / Field Validation Demostration

Schema Data Relations & Querying Documents

Types of Embedded document relations explained

Types of Relations for Referenced Documents Explained

Creating Data in one to one relations

Creating Data in one to many relations

Creating Data with in Nested Documents

Updating documents with nested data

Removing a value from a array

Deleting a field with its data from a document

Indexes & Aggregation

Creating an Index

Default Index and handy function

Creating a compound index

Joining Collections

Connecting mongoDB to APPS

Using mongoDB to Node.js

Using mongoDB with Python



Yacine15 October 2020

l'instructeur parle trop rapidement, je pense qu'il y a des erreurs de transcriptions dans les sous titres

Tom22 December 2019

This is a beginners course, and it's okay if someone only wants to learn the mechanics. However, I think it would be helpful to sprinkle in a little what and why instead of just how. Also, you should have least referred to the Mongo web site for additional documentation on the exact set of commands/options, especially since the online web site indicates what's supported for the programming language you're going to use.


12/4/2019100% OFFExpired


Udemy ID


Course created date


Course Indexed date
Course Submitted by